Diwali

 This week Hindu's celebrate Diwali, so in Year 1 we have been finding out more about this celebration.
 
We decorated glass jars to make our own Diwali lights.
 
 






We made Diwali cards.
 





 
 
We used chalks to create Rangoli patterns.
 







We drew around our feet, cut them out and decorated them.  During Diwali footprints are used to encourage the goddess Lakshmi into houses.








 






 
Using condensed milk and cocoa powder we made Diwali sweets called Barfi.  Sweets are shared with family and friends during the celebration.
 




We heard the story of Rama and Sita and enjoyed re-telling it with our friends.
 


 
We thought carefully about Diwali and wrote what we had learnt.
